Understanding OER/OCWOpen Content, Open Ed

Open Content

Open Educational Resources

OpenCourseWare

Open Content - any kind of creative work that explicitly allows the copying of the information.

(http://en.wikipedia.org/wikiOpen_content 10/6/2006)

Open Educational Resources - digitized materials offered freely and openly to use and re-use for teaching, learning and research.

(http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/_Openeducational_resources 10/6/2006)

OpenCourseWare - A free and open digital publication of high-quality educational materials, organized as courses.

Covers:• The entire undergraduate and graduate curriculum• 33 academic departments

Voluntary contributions from:• 78% of MIT faculty • 2,600 members of the MIT community• More than 7,100 individuals and organizations in total

MIT OpenCourseWareOpen License

Obliges users to meet three use requirements:

Use must be non-commercial

Materials must be attributed to MIT and original authoror contributor

Publication or distribution of original or derivativematerials must be offered freely under identical terms,or “share alike”

How OCW is UsedSelf Learner Use

Megan BrewsterVolunteer materials scientist with

Appropriate Infrastructure Development Group, Guatemala, used OCW to develop a locally appropriate protocol for recycling discarded water

bottles.

Page 39: Unlocking Knowledge, Empowering Minds

39 Unlocking Knowledge, Empowering Minds

How OCW is UsedSelf Learner Use

“I returned to OCW again and againfor information on plastics,

recycling technologies, water filtration, and more. The project

was a success, and we could not have done it without OCW.”
